$50M Growth Facility Fuels AlayaCare’s Expansion Ambitions

  • $50 million growth capital facility provided by CIBC Innovation Banking to AlayaCare Inc.
  • Funding supports AlayaCare’s expansion and strategic M&A in home/community care software sector.
  • CIBC has backed AlayaCare since its founding in 2014, reflecting long-term partnership.
  • AlayaCare operates a cloud-based platform serving over 600 employees across Canada and the U.S.

CIBC’s $50 million commitment underscores the growing demand for scalable solutions in fragmented home/community care markets. The deal reflects a broader trend of financial institutions backing vertical SaaS providers targeting aging populations and shifting healthcare delivery models. With over $11 billion in managed funds, CIBC Innovation Banking is doubling down on growth-stage health tech companies poised for international expansion.
